November 19Nov 19 NOVEMBER 14--A motorist told police that he was busy attempting to urinate into a Budweiser can when he accidentally plowed into another vehicle on a Montana roadway, according to court records. As detailed in a probable cause affidavit, James Howard, 53, was driving his Chevrolet Suburban on a Missoula roadway when he slammed into the rear of a Volkswagen carrying two passengers. A Highway Patrol officer who arrived at the crash scene Thursday evening reported seeing Howard with “a large Budweiser beer can in his right hand, which he moved into the center console.” Howard, cops say, handed over the beer can “when asked and said it contained urine and not beer.” He further explained that he “rear-ended the vehicle because he was attempting to urinate into the beer can while driving.” The Volkswagen’s driver told cops he was at a stop light after exiting Interstate 90 when he “saw lights approaching in his rearview mirror and told his girlfriend to brace for impact.” Howard--who claimed to have consumed only one beer--reportedly smelled of alcohol, his speech was “slow and slurred,” and his pants were wet with urine. “Howard stated that he had ‘more than a couple of DUI’s’ and was not supposed to be driving,” the affidavit notes. “I’m going to jail for a fucking long time,” Howard told cops. A police check of Howard’s driver history showed that his license had been suspended earlier this month, and that he had four prior impaired driving convictions. A post-crash Intoxilyzer test registered his blood alcohol concentration at more than three times the legal limit. Howard was arrested for aggravated DUI, a felony, and reckless driving and driving with a suspended license, both misdemeanors. He is being held in the county jail in lieu of $10,000 bond. (3 pages)

November 25Nov 25 BANGKOK (AP) — A woman in Thailand shocked temple staff when she started moving in her coffin after being brought in for cremation. Wat Rat Prakhong Tham, a Buddhist temple in the province of Nonthaburi on the outskirts of Bangkok, posted a video on its Facebook page, showing a woman lying in a white coffin in the back of a pick-up truck, slightly moving her arms and head, leaving temple staff bewildered. Pairat Soodthoop, the temple’s general and financial affairs manager, told The Associated Press on Monday that the 65-year-old woman’s brother drove her from the province of Phitsanulok to be cremated. He said they heard a faint knock coming from the coffin. “I was a bit surprised, so I asked them to open the coffin, and everyone was startled,” he said. “I saw her opening her eyes slightly and knocking on the side of the coffin. She must have been knocking for quite some time.” According to Pairat, the brother said his sister had been bedridden for about two years, when her health deteriorated and she became unresponsive, appearing to stop breathing two days ago. The brother then placed her in a coffin and made the 500-kilometer (300-mile) journey to a hospital in Bangkok, to which the woman had previously expressed a wish to donate her organs. The hospital refused to accept the brother’s offer as he didn’t have an official death certificate, Pairat said. His temple offers a free cremation service, which is why the brother approached them on Sunday, but was also refused due to the missing document. The temple manager said that while he was explaining how to get a death certificate when they heard the knocking. They then assessed her and sent her to a nearby hospital. The abbot said the temple would cover her medical expenses, according to Pairat.

December 3Dec 3 Quote One Virginia liquor store had an unusual patron this weekend -- an inebriated raccoon found passed out in the bathroom. According to the Hanover County Animal Protection and Shelter, authorities found the "masked bandit" collapsed in the bathroom of the Ashland ABC Store Saturday morning, where the furry burglar had ransacked shelves and drank multiple types of alcohol. In a social media post, officials said they took the "very intoxicated" raccoon back to the shelter to sober up before releasing him back into the wild. "After a few hours of sleep and zero signs of injury (other than maybe a hangover and poor life choices), he was safely released back to the wild, hopefully having learned that breaking and entering is not the answer," the Facebook post read.
